About Mt. San Antonio College (Tennis Court)

Mt. San Antonio College tennis courts in Walnut, CA host pickleball on 11 outdoor hard courts. Public college facility with coaches available for lessons.

When to come
A steady-traffic venue. Lessons book up fastest on weekday evenings and weekend mornings.
Amenities
  • Parking: Multiple parking lots available including L, R, S near tennis courts (730T at E-6 on athletic map).
  • Outdoor facility
  • Entrance: Tennis courts (730T) located at E-6 on Mt. SAC athletic facility map, accessible via 1100 N Grand Ave.
